The Legendary 1979 Orchestra - Disco Bucuresti

Disco Bucuresti is an audio homage to Romania's capital, Bucharest. Growing up between the city's communist blocks of flats and maturing in the city's underground discos left a distinct creative mark on Andrei Idu (The Legendary 1979 Orchestra). Ever since leaving Bucharest for Amsterdam, Andrei felt the need to tribute the place that shaped him. However, it was only until recently that he found the means necessary to express the feelings he felt. Thus, records released during the 70s and 80s in Romania as sole sample source, analog drum machines, delays, filters and reverbs, all recorded in live takes come together in this evocative EP.

Saint Petersburg Disco Spin Club / The Legendary 1979 Orch - Nightdriving / Love Triangle Theme

All killer no filler on the new Legendary Sound Research release! We've got a split double A-side EP from The Saint Petersburg Disco Spin Club and head researcher of the label, The Legendary 1979 Orchestra.

SPDSC's 'Nightdriving' sounds like the soundtrack to an early 80s exploitation movie featuring crazy driving stunts! JKriv, of Deep & Disco fame, flips the track into a mid tempo piano driven stomper adding even more action to the scenes.

On the flip side, The Legendary 1979 Orchestra's 'Love Triangle Theme' is the actual soundtrack to the opening scene of the short horror film 'Matasari'. The track is moody and tensed but somehow liberating with its groovyness. Taking care of remix duties is analog veteran Ruf Dug. His take is reverby, atmospheric, sounding straight off a lost proto house tape.

Borrowed Identity - Je T'aime

Borrowed Identity is based in the small city of Freiburg, Germany. However, his sound is BIG!
Being influenced by early Chicago and Detroit house and techno, he produces deep emotional compositions that move both soul and body. Je T'Aime is no exception. The four tracks included in the EP tell a story of autumn nostalgia for one special summer. The cure for the nostalgia is offered as well through the analog fatness of the bass lines and the sophisticated drum patterns and grooves.
